Description

With the Bloomberg Connects app, explore interactive guides to over 350 museums, galleries, gardens, and cultural spaces from the palm of your hand. From behind-the-scenes guides to artist and expert-curated video and audio content, Bloomberg Connects makes it easy to discover arts and culture – anytime, anywhere.

• Plan and Discover: Prepare for your visit with our planning tools, then use the lookup numbers onsite for quick information about an unexpected find.

• On-Demand Content: Use the app onsite or on its own to bring exhibitions and collections to life with exclusive multimedia content created by our museum collaborators.

Bloomberg Philanthropies created the app to help make the art and offerings of cultural organizations more accessible – not just to those visiting in person but to people around the world.

Use the app to discover museums and cultural spaces in 25+ cities worldwide including — Brooklyn Museum, Central Park Conservancy, The DuSable Black History Museum, The Frick Collection, Georgia O’Keeffe Museum, Guggenheim Museum, Hammer Museum, ICA/Boston, Jewish Museum, The Met, MoMA, New York Botanical Garden, The New York Public Library, Noguchi Museum, The Phillips Collection, Serpentine, Sir John Soane’s Museum, Storm King Art Center, Tate, Yorkshire Sculpture Park and more.

Bloomberg Connects benefits our partners – over 350 museums, galleries, gardens, and cultural spaces, with more joining every month – by providing a pre-built, easy-to-use app interface that can be customized to their content and mission.

Poorly designed app that is annoying to use in a museum

ipd? on

The use case of his app is very frequently pulling your phone from your pocket/purse and quickly accessing information. QUICKLY is the important word, but it fails at that. First, every time I open the app, it freezes for 5-10 seconds. Why? Who knows. Also the back button fails to work much of the time. Let's say that I'm in a gallery, and the numbers of each artwork increases sequentially. Not all galleries do this, but probably common enough. So if I'm at artwork #405 and need to get to #406 which is right next to it, there should obviously be a button to do that, right? Nope. I have back out, and input 406. FOR EVERY SINGLE ARTWORK. so frustrating.

Great idea, poor execution

mtandcj on

Excellent idea to allow downloadable guide content for visiting museum, and rich with text and videos. However, you DO have to have internet (wifi or cellular) to find and open the content for the museum you are visiting. Why? Also, very annoyingly, each time the app gets switched out of memory (because you've launched other apps, etc.) you have to get online again to search for your museum and relaunch the content. Incredible that the app doesn't remember what musuem you were at literally 5 minutes previous.
